Richard Edelman’s Stolen Portraits at the Center for Photography at Woodstock

The Center for Photography at Woodstock is hosting Richard Edelman’s exhibition Stolen Portraits, featuring fictional portraits of creative people in the region. The series includes collaborations with Rebekah Creshkoff, Jen Dragon, Elaine Mayes, and others. An opening reception will take place Saturday, February 20 at 5 pm. Edelman’s photographs are included in public collections at the Metropolitan Museum of Art, the Canadian Centre for Architecture, the Brooklyn Museum, the Bibliothèque Nationale, and the Samuel Dorsky Museum, while other work can be found at the MoMA artist book collection, the Whitney Museum of American Art, and the Sackner Archive of Concrete and Visual Poetry. Stitch and Sip: Samplers 1.0 Quilting Workshop at Olana

Olana State Historic Site, the home of celebrated painter Frederic Edwin Church in Catskill, is hosting a quilting workshop this Saturday, February 20 from 4 to 6 pm, as part of a series taught by Sandra Feck. Feck is the Vice President of the Capital District Chapter of the Embroiderers’ Guild of America. Church and his wife Isabel collected a variety of embroidered textiles and quilts while at Olana, as they both loved color and texture. This workshop will mix needlework with socialization, building on a long tradition of quilting as a social function. Learn more at olana.org.

New York in Bloom at the New York State Museum in Albany

The New York State Museum in Albany is hosting its 25th annual New York in Bloom celebration this weekend, Friday through Sunday, February 19 – 21, from 9:30 am to 5 pm. Hundreds of floral arrangements and garden galleries will be displayed throughout the museum. Activities include music, lectures and demonstrations, illustration and design tips, and much more.
